Manager overseeing assessment and improvement of Welfare and Self-Reliance products and services. Ensures impactful delivery of humanitarian efforts worldwide with an emphasis on strategic evaluation and reporting.
Responsibilities
Develop and oversee processes and tools to ensure Church-provided funds are used as intended, reach the right people, and create the intended impact.
Design and implement monitoring and evaluation data collection systems and frameworks to track outputs, outcomes, and impact across all Welfare and Self-Reliance and Humanitarian products, services, and operations.
Identify, meet, and develop working relationships with partners/vendors in the effort to evaluate if products, goods, and services are provided to the right people at the right time throughout the world.
Review performance and analytics to ensure milestones are met and deliverables achieved.
Analyze, synthesize, and communicate findings, learnings, and strategic considerations to stakeholders, operations, and external implementing organizations.
Facilitate the design and implementation of new/improved process tools to assist in the process of measuring the effectiveness of Church-funded efforts and to help WSRS implement evaluation findings to continuously improve the work.
Provide performance reporting to headquarters governing councils and area governing councils.
Manages the modification of systems and processes, the adaptation of existing systems and processes to better support the Department and ensures that work is done as effectively as possible.
The incumbent regularly manages the work of other employees (may include mixed workforce) and volunteers, and is authorized in partnership with HR, to hire or fire employees and recommends advancements, promotion, or any other change of status of employees within their reporting line.
Requirements
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Statistics, International Development, Public Health, Research, or equivalent field.
Minimum of 10 years of applicable experience, or equivalent education and experience.
Recognized ability to positively and effectively lead critical and highly visible work.
Possess strong ability to understand and align with key strategic objectives.
Proven ability to understand complex business processes and structures and to recommend changes.
Proven analytical and critical thinking skills.
Excellent interpersonal skills and proven capability in managing and motivating a team of professionals.
Preferred
Master's Degree in a relevant discipline
